Many businesses, including warehouses, hotels, schools, restaurants, delivery services, government offices and even theatres use cash deposit bags. They are easy yet secure in many ways to transport cash from one hand to another. Any operation that handles cash or valuables chooses cash deposit bags for internal cash protection. However, we see that banks frequently use reusable cash deposit bags.

 

Cash deposit bags are returnable deposit bags protected by a high-security system. It is ideal for storing and transporting coins, checks and valuable documents. Windows for framing nameplate holders, convenient for name tags or business cards, can be added to the cash deposit bags.

 

Cash deposit bags are sealable money bags to transport money safely.

 

Cash deposit bags are super secure money bags used in various industries, including banking, retail and security. They are tamper-evident, durable, weather resistant and robust enough to transport large amounts of cash and coins. Designed to ensure tamper evidence is obvious, Cash deposit bags are a simple yet effective way to transport some money and receipts. Cash deposit bags are recommended for transporting flat letter size (8 x 11) files or documents, 12 x 16 or larger. These secure money bags are a way to transport money tamper-evidently.

 

High-quality cash deposit bags can be used more than 2,000 times and are guaranteed for five years. These cash deposit bags feature the tamper-evident zip closure, which, when numbered or barcoded, makes it easy to track and trace, ensures chain of custody and, for added peace of mind. The main characteristic of the high-security cash deposit bags for storing valuables is their VOID security tape. It leaves ample evidence of tampering when it is opened. The money bag is never open to fraud when trying to open the glue on the tape with solvent or antifreeze. The edges of the money envelopes have a security message that cannot be altered.

Some cash deposit bags are entirely opaque, covered on the inside by a black film and have a detachable foliated receipt. They have a “hot-melt” self-sealing adhesive closure system for unauthorized opening attempts. Once the bag is sealed, any attempt to enter its contents by manipulating the seal will cause a universal STOP message to appear. The sides with rule marks and names are provided to avoid tampering.
